Dairy, cholov yisroel, and what to look for
A kosher dairy restaurant serves no meat, so meat and milk are never combined. The main question for many diners is the standard of the milk itself. Cholov yisroel means the milk was supervised from the moment of milking, while cholov stam relies on a well-known ruling that permits government-regulated dairy.
Every dairy listing marks whether it is cholov yisroel, and where the baked goods are pas yisroel, so you can hold to your standard. Remember that after a meat meal you generally wait before eating dairy, so a dairy restaurant is best at the start of the day or as a meal on its own.
